On September 22, 1791, Michael Faraday was born in Newington Butts, England. Faraday was a brilliant scientist who made groundbreaking discoveries in the fields of electromagnetism and electrochemistry. Despite having little formal education, he became one of the most influential scientists of the 19th century.
Faraday's curiosity and passion for science led him to make several crucial observations and experiments. In 1821, he discovered electromagnetic rotation, demonstrating that a wire carrying an electric current could rotate around a magnetic pole. This principle later became the foundation for the development of electric motors.
Another significant contribution by Faraday was his work on electromagnetic induction. In 1831, he discovered that a changing magnetic field could induce an electric current in a nearby conductor. This discovery paved the way for the development of electrical generators and transformers, which revolutionized the production and distribution of electricity.
Faraday also made important contributions to the field of electrochemistry. He introduced the concepts of anode, cathode, electrode, and ion, which are still used in modern chemistry. His work on electrolysis led to the establishment of the laws of electrolysis, known as Faraday's laws.
Throughout his career, Faraday remained dedicated to sharing his knowledge with the public. He gave numerous lectures at the Royal Institution in London, which were attended by both scientific and lay audiences. His engaging and accessible presentations helped popularize science and inspire future generations of scientists.
Faraday's legacy extends beyond his scientific achievements. He was known for his humility, integrity, and strong moral principles. Albert Einstein kept a picture of Faraday on his study wall, alongside pictures of Isaac Newton and James Clerk Maxwell, as a tribute to Faraday's significant contributions to science.
